Optus to acquire Amaysim, launches Gomo digital brand

2020-11-02 07:12:00| Telecompaper Headlines

(Telecompaper) Australian operator Optus has unveiled its plans on the local MVNO market. The company has agreed to purchase the Amaysim MVNO mobile business. Optus has also introduced its 'Gomo' digital brand. Optus reports Gomo will target customers seeking simple plans and budget-friendly telecom services. [ more ]
